Output ed51660bdeaa75d814f88412669589f710000c18849956ed9bc0d07100472613:0

value
53918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99f7c7dfa1be97690866be7cbacef41747671be1 OP_EQUALVERIFY OP_CHECKSIG
address
muZ4WWhQWfon2jm7cp49u1ui2wNQ1Upwzf
transaction
ed51660bdeaa75d814f88412669589f710000c18849956ed9bc0d07100472613
spent
true